Day 1: A Clean and Healthy Start
Start your day with a bowl of oats prepared in milk or water. Add fresh fruits like apple or banana to increase fiber content. This breakfast keeps you full and prevents mid-morning cravings.
For lunch, eat two chapatis with mixed vegetable curry and a bowl of curd. This meal provides balanced nutrition and supports digestion.
In the evening, snack on roasted chana or a handful of nuts. Avoid processed snacks as they contain empty calories.
Dinner should be light. A bowl of vegetable soup or dal with salad helps your body relax and digest food easily.
Day 2: Building Consistency
Begin your morning with warm water and lemon. This simple habit improves hydration and supports digestion.
For breakfast, choose vegetable poha or upma. These meals are light yet satisfying.
Lunch should include brown rice, dal, and a vegetable dish. Brown rice contains more fiber, making it a better option for weight management.
In the evening, eat fruits like papaya or apple. For dinner, include grilled paneer or tofu with vegetables to increase protein intake.
Day 3: Increasing Protein Intake
Protein plays a key role in any meal plan for weight loss. It helps reduce hunger and boosts metabolism.
Start your day with a smoothie made from milk, banana, and a few almonds. This provides energy and nutrients.
For lunch, eat chapatis with rajma or chole. These are rich in protein and fiber.
In the evening, drink green tea with roasted peanuts. Dinner should include vegetable khichdi with salad to keep it light.
Day 4: Staying on Track
Consistency is the foundation of a successful diet planner for weight loss. On this day, focus on maintaining balance.
Start with soaked almonds and warm water. For breakfast, eat a vegetable omelette or besan chilla.
Lunch can include chapati, dal, and green vegetables. Snack on yogurt or fruits in the evening.
Dinner should be light, such as soup with a small portion of paneer or chicken.
Day 5: Improving Energy Levels
By day five, your body starts adapting to your 7 day diet plan for weight loss. You may feel more energetic and less hungry.
For breakfast, eat oats or whole grain toast with peanut butter. Lunch can include quinoa or brown rice with vegetables and dal.
In the evening, drink coconut water or eat fruit salad.
Dinner should include stir-fried vegetables with tofu or paneer to maintain a low calorie intake.
Day 6: Supporting Digestion
Start your day with lemon water again. Breakfast can include idli with sambar, which is light and easy to digest.
Lunch should include chapati, sabzi, and curd. This combination supports gut health.
Snack on nuts or seeds in the evening. Dinner should be simple, such as soup or grilled vegetables.
Day 7: Reset and Refresh
The final day of your 7 day diet plan for weight loss focuses on light eating.
Start with a fruit bowl and yogurt. Lunch can include vegetable pulao with minimal oil.
In the evening, drink green tea with a few almonds. Dinner should be very light, such as salad or soup.

Foods You Should Avoid
While following a diet planner for weight loss, avoid sugary drinks, fried foods, and processed snacks. These foods add unnecessary calories and slow down your progress.
Refined carbohydrates like white bread and pastries can increase cravings. Replacing them with whole foods improves your results.
Common Mistakes That Slow Down Weight Loss
Many people follow a 7 day diet plan for weight loss but still struggle due to common mistakes. Skipping meals slows down metabolism and leads to overeating later.
Relying on packaged diet foods often adds hidden sugars. Not drinking enough water also affects digestion and fat loss.
Ignoring physical activity can slow progress. Even a simple daily walk can make a big difference.
